Product CenterWhy Australia's Home Battery Systems Face New Cybersecurity Challenges
The rise of home battery technology in Australia, particularly in urban centers like Sydney and Melbourne, has led to significant advancements in energy storage solutions. However, as these systems become more integrated with digital technologies, the need for robust cybersecurity measures has never been more critical. Recent developments highlight a growing concern about the potential vulnerabilities associated with home battery installations.
This heightened scrutiny stems in part from increasing incidents of cyberattacks targeting smart devices. With more Australians opting to install home battery systems for efficient energy use and cost savings, the focus has shifted to ensuring these systems are not only effective but also secure from potential breaches.
In response to these threats, Australian regulatory bodies are stepping up efforts to establish comprehensive cybersecurity compliance standards for home battery systems. The Australian Energy Market Operator (AEMO) has been at the forefront of this initiative, collaborating with manufacturers and stakeholders to develop guidelines that protect consumers from cyber threats while promoting innovation in energy technology.
These new regulations will require home battery manufacturers to implement stringent security protocols to safeguard user data and ensure the operational integrity of their systems. This compliance not only protects consumers but also enhances the credibility of manufacturers in a rapidly evolving marketplace.

As consumers become more reliant on home battery systems for energy storage, understanding the cybersecurity landscape is essential. Buyers are encouraged to inquire about the security features of the home battery systems they consider. Factors such as data encryption, regular security updates, and the manufacturer’s compliance with national standards should be part of the decision-making process.
